AHS seniors earn College Board recognition | News, Sports, Jobs


Collin Lightfoot
Four Alpena High School Seniors were recognized with the National Rural and Small Town Recognition Program from College Board.
Amelia Berles, Jade Gray, Alexis Jones, and Collin Lightfoot were recognized by the College Board for their overall academic career and performance on last October’s NMSQT.
The College Board National Recognition Programs create pathways to college for students from underrepresented communities by awarding them academic honors and connecting them with universities across the country. To be eligible for this program, students must take the PSAT/NMSQT in October of their junior year, achieve the minimum requested PSAT/NMSQT score, earn a cumulative GPA of 3.5 or higher by the middle of their junior year, and attend school in a rural area or small town. ....

Farmington students honored by national African American recognition program


Four Farmington Public Schools’ seniors were honored by the College Board National African American Recognition Program.
The selected students were Terrence Bartell, senior class president, and Alden Wiredu, of North Farmington High School, and Cameron Duplessis and Eric Winston of Farmington High School. Through this designation, the teens received academic honors, and they were connected with universities across the country.
To qualify to receive a College Board National Recognition, students must identify as African American, Hispanic or Latinx, Indigenous, and/or attend school in a rural area or small town; achieve the minimum requested PSAT/NMSQT score; and earn a cumulative GPA of 3.5 or higher by the middle of their junior year. ....
